![]() | Shoulder clicking? (NINEPACK?) Hi guys. For a few weeks now my right shoulder has been very "clicky." I have full ROM and no pain in moving it but if i put hand on it while i move it i can feel it clicking, popping, cracking etc... It initially started at random one morning, it kinda feels like ive slept on badly but has got no better. Just to add, i have included prehab work for my rotator cuff for several month now. Also my rowing movements are slightly stronger than my pushing movements, does this mean an imbalance or overpowering front delts are not likely? Im just wandering if anybody could give me an idea of what the problem could be. Thanks alot! Tom |

Don't worry too much bud, my shoulders feel like a ratchet sometimes, and have done for years but I have no injures there. It may be worth considering a decent joint support supplement (I use Pro tect) but there are many other good ones out there. Just make sure to warm up thoroughly & do some rotational movements as part of your normal training regime for your RC & keep away from any behind the neck movements. if you are really concerned, it may be worth the money going to see a good sports physio even if it's just to confirm that there's nothing to worry about.

Identifying suspected injury to the RC muscles can be aided by specific ROM tests like the 'empty can test' & 'painful arc test' (google them, you may find something). I'd see what the physio says though as without actually examining it myself it is very hard to say.
